King Charles III underwent a scheduled procedure due to an enlarged prostate, Buckingham Palace confirmed on Friday. Here's what to know about the condition.
The treatment was successful and the king is "doing quite well," a royal source told Fox News Digital. It is also important for men to take an inventory of the type of fluid they're consuming. "We don’t know what causes some men to have larger prostates than others." "The prostate is one of the few organs in the human body that continues to grow during adulthood."
The palace emphasized that his condition is non-cancerous.
